One day your children will ask
One day your children will ask
Answering them is no easy task
You will indeed reply
You will smother their cries.
Dad, what is this thing called war?
Dad, why do they stretch a fight so far?
The tears will well up in your eyes
While they will toss and turn at night.
Mum, why do innocent children die?
Mum, where will the helpless women hide?
You will gingerly squeeze their hand
But the one truth will not stand.
If you could find the answers
If God could grant you the chances
But how do we tell them?
How do we introduce our children to hell?
Wars just cannot be understood
The terrorists will always use the ugly hood
The politicians will toast to hatred
With money the enemy will be tempted.
But one day it will all stop
One fine day, the bombs will not drop
We will all wake up from this nightmare
We will not get trapped into this snare.
Everybody will speak one language
Love will send us on an eventful voyage
The nations will forget their loathing
Indeed a new day will be dawning.
That day is not a mere dream
Our wishes will not be muffled by a scream
Just believe in God?s prophecy
And put a cross on infamy.
Jesus sacrificed himself for us
In Allah we will always trust
Buddha was another messenger
Lord Krishna awakened our conscience deeper.
You don?t need a temple to pray
In our hearts the One will forever stay
He said: ?Lift a stone, split a piece of wood
And you will find Me?.
